Bald Eagle State Park




Visitors may choose from a wide selection of recreational opportunities which include: swimming, picnicking, boating, fishing, water-skiing, hiking, both primitive and modern camping, environmental education programs, ice fishing, ice skating, cross country skiing, sled and tobogganing, boat rentals and a marina with 368 marina dockage spaces. A variety of hiking trails are available at the park including the park's 1.5 mile long Butterfly Trail. These trails total 7.5 miles and are also available for cross-country skiing.

Recommended Activities

  • Take advantage of walks and hikes lead by the park environmental education specialist.
  • Hike the park's 1.5 mile long Butterfly Trail.
  • Ice Fishing and Ice Boating: Crappies, bluegill and large and small mouth bass are the predominant species of game fish.
  • Approximately 11.5 miles of trail are available for cross-country skiing.
